0

Membuat Jam Waktu Solat (JWS) / Prayers Time Menggunakan Arduino + Sensor Suhu

Bismillahirrahmanirrahim, Assalamualaikum teman-teman dimanapun berada semoga senantiasa selalu berada di lindungan Allah SWT. Hari ini adalah hari ke ke 26 saya berada dirumah dalam rangka mencegah penyebaran virus corona dan mendukung program pemerintah, memang sangat membosankan apabila harus selalu berdiam diri di rumah tanpa melakukan kegiatan apapun. Oleh karena itu, saya menghibur diri agar tidak merasa bosan dengan mencoba beberapa hal baru dan menuntaskan project yang sempat tertunda salah satunya ya Jam Waktu Solat ini atau biasa orang menyebutnya JWS.

Pada project yang saya share kali ini saya berharap semoga saya dapat memberikan manfaat bagi orang banyak. Pada project ini saya hanya menggunakan LCD 1602 atau 16×2 untuk display nya, tidak menggunakan panel P10, karena disini saya hanya berniat dipasang di rumah saja. Tanpa basa-basi lagi kita masuk ke bahan-bahan yang harus dipersiapkan

antara lain:

Arduino UNO

I2C/IIC LCD Backpack

Kabel Jumper Secukupnya


RTC DS1307

DHT22

LCD 1602 / 16X2

Bagaimana sudah mengumpulkan bahannya?? kalau sudah mari kita lanjut masuk ke skematik untuk merangkainya. Perhatikan baik-baik gambar di bawah ini ya jangan sampai salah mengubungkannya.

Sketch Arduino JWS + DHT22

Sudah?? sekali lagi pastikan rangkaiannya sudah betul ya, dan pastikan juga sambungannya cukup kokoh, khususnya kabel yang berkaitan dengan LCD nya, karena kalau tidak nanti tulisan yang muncul di LCD nya jadi acak-acakan atau paling parah tidak muncul.

Sekarang kita masuk ke pembahasan program JWS, dalam program JWS ini ada hal penting yang harus di perhatikan seperti posisi anda saat ini. Yang berperan sangat penting untuk memunculkan jadwal solat yang akurat. Saya ambil contoh dalam program untuk memasukkan posisi saya yang berada di daerah bandung barat

// pengaturan bujur lintang (Sindangkerta)
float _lat = -6.985551;    // lintang
float _lng = 107.413885;   // bujur

// timezone
int _timezone = 7; // zona waktu WIB=7, WITA=8, WIT=9

Bagaimana cara melihat bujur dan lintang posisi kita?? caranya mudah sekali anda buka maps dan nyalakan fitur lokasi gps agar maps bisa mendeteksi posisi kalian saat ini

Lokasi

Perhatikan yang di dalam warna merah, ambil nilainya dan masukkan ke dalam program bagian lintang dan yang warna kuning masukkan ke dalam bagian bujur. dan untuk timezone nya sendiri sesuaikan apakah daerah kalian masuk ke dalam WIB, WITA atau WIT.

untuk source code lengkapnya kalian bisa download file di bawah ini

Untuk Password nya kalian bisa kunjungi video kami di youtube melalui link dibawah ini:

https://www.youtube.com/watch?v=BXNTBVZmVfM&t=13s

Terima kasih buat kalian yang sudah menyimak sampai akhir, semoga ini bemanfaat untuk kalian. Oh iya terakhir saya minta support kalian untuk mengunjungi instagram kami di @idngulik (jangan lupa follow hehe) dan kunjungi kami di youtube Ngulik ID (subscribe ya :D). Sekian dari saya, mohon maaf bila ada salah-salah kata dan apabila ada yang kurang di mengerti kalian bisa menghubungi kami melalui IG. Wassalamualaikum stay safe dan sering-sering cuci tangan ya

rp.rusdiana

Leave a Reply

Your email address will not be published. Required fields are marked *